Leo Posted November 27, 2023 Posted November 27, 2023 Northwestern started playing football in 1882. Fitz took over in 2006. Northwestern made six bowl during that span. Fitz made 10 bowl games between 2006 and 2022. He won at least six games in 11 seasons. He had three 10 win seasons and two other 9 win seasons. He won 5 bowl games. Sure he fizzled out in his last four seasons, but he won at least six games in 10 of 12 years before his last four seasons. 9 bowl games in 12 years (IU has played 13 bowl games in our entire history).
